Introduction The Abdus Salam International Centre for Theoretical Physics (ICTP) and the Trieste University have initiated in 2014 a Master of Advanced Studies in Medical Physics a two-years training programme in Medical Physics. The programme is designated to provide young promising graduates in physics, mainly from developing countries, with a post-graduated theoretical and clinical training suitable to be recognised as Clinical Medical Physicist in their countries. Presently, the 3 cycles of the programme have seen 49 participants from 33 Countries: Africa (19), Asia (11), Central and South America (14), and Europe (5), selected from more than 400 applicants per year. Scholarships are awarded to candidates from developing countries with support of the IAEA, TWAS (Third World Academy of Sciences), KFAS (Kuwait Foundation for the Advancement of Sciences), ACS (American Cancer Society), IOMP, EFOMP and ICTP.
